Data Reporting Analyst Salary and JobData Reporting Analyst Salary and JobYou find data reporting analysts in just about every industry. Their primary responsibility is creating reports highlighting how the business is doing - and theyre in high demand.The opportunities for data reporting analysts outnumber the available candidates 4 to 1 in my market, said Kevin Ngo, Technology division director in Princeton, New Jersey.Using visualization, metrics, reports and analysis, data reporting analysts take raw data - sales or marketing data, for example - and present it to the team or management to help them make data-driven decisions for the company.Heres a closer look at the job.Data reporting analyst salaryAccording to the 2019 Technology Salary Guide, the midpoint starting salary for data reporting analysts is $74,000, with the higher end of starting compensation reaching $110,000 and the lower end at $59,000.GET THE SALARY GUIDEKeep in mind that a candidates experience level and lo cation can impact starting salary. Use our Salary Calculator to find out what a data reporting analyst can earn in your city.Data reporting analyst job dutiesThe responsibilities of a data reporting analyst may differ depending on the size and goals of the company, but in general duties includePulling data to develop recurring or one-time reportsBuilding dashboards for sales or managers to show resultsMaintaining databases, spreadsheets and other tools used in data analysisLocating and fixing errors in reportsTraining others on how to use and create reportsProfessional experience and skillsData reporting analyst jobs require some coding and mathematics, and candidates should have expertise in SQL scripting, SSRS, SSIS, ETL, PowerBi, Tableau and other reporting tools.In addition to technical skills, data reporting analysts should be excellent communicators. The ability to communicate with business teams, end users and executives is vital to the job, said Ngo. Often, a data reporting analyst is working directly with business teams to understand reporting requirements.Data reporting analysts may receive requests from teams with different priorities, and so must be able to prioritize tasks. They also may be asked to customize software to present data. Knowledge of statistics and critical thinking skills are additional keys to success in this job.The job generally requires a four-year college degree with an emphasis in computer science or information technology.Data reporting analyst interview questionsIf youre interviewing for a data reporting analyst job, or a hiring manager interviewing data reporting analysts, here are some questions you might encounter or askWhat is your process for understanding business requirements before translating them to reports or dashboards?What types of data do you have experience working with?What tools have you used to develop reports, dashboards and visualizations?How have you worked with multiple departments?How have your reports helped change your organizations strategies?Along with other data-related jobs, data reporting analysts are likely to remain in high demand as businesses continue to use data and metrics to measure performance. Its a great time to move into this field.

The only real way to acquire wisdomThe only real way to acquire wisdomIts often been saidthatwisdom is the art of knowing that you are elend wise.The great philosopher Socrates famouslydenied being wisemora than two thousand years ago, and since then, we have taken him at his word.There is a truth there, but thatdefinitionisnt very helpful.I mean, Im all for respecting uncertainty, doubting oneself, and realizing the limitations of my mind, but I think we cando better. Maybeeven take a few steps forward.Follow Ladders on FlipboardFollow Ladders magazines on Flipboard covering Happiness, Productivity, Job Satisfaction, Neuroscience, and moraMore importantly, I think we can create our own definition that separates it from just mere intelligence and then use that definition to illustrate why the distinction matters and how we can practically engage it in everyday life.Intelligence is commonlyassociatedwith knowing something.Often,it also means that we can confidentlyapply what we know i n a particular context.Wisdom, to me, is different. Its differentbecauseit has more dimensions.Wisdom not only knows, but it also understands.Andthedistinction between knowing and understanding is what makes things interesting.Knowing is generally factual. You have learned a particular kind of knowledge and you know its truth as it applies to a particular problem.Understanding, however, is more fluid.You have learned a particular kind of knowledge, but you dont see it as a fact or a truth applied rigidly to one thing.Rather,youunderstand that knowledges essence and you can see how it relates to everything else,withnuancesand contradictions included.The difference issubtlebutpotent.Whileintelligence gives you specificutility,wisdom inspires flexibleversatility.Itprovides a more textured lens for interactingwith reality,very much changing how you think.Building relational knowledgeEvery time you have aperspective shift, big or small, you gain knowledge.You learn something new that you maybe didnt know before, and as a result, your mind then changes itself regarding whatever that knowledge pertains to in the future. Next time, there is an added clarity.If the acquired knowledge is understood, rather than just known, however, there is another step that occurs every time your mind shifts.If youre a student, for example, and youre writing an exam, and its a difficult one, lets say you decide to cheat. Now, unfortunately, when you cheat, you get caught. It leads to a failing grade in the course.The thing to learn from this experience that would add to your intelligence would be the fact that cheating on an exam has consequences, andthose consequences, whileimprobable,have adisproportionatelynegative impact on your life.Its simply not worth it in the future.The extra step that would translate the intelligence in that particular scenario into broadly applicable wisdomwould be to realize that not only isnot worth cheating on an exam due to the harsh consequences,but tha tmost things in the world that carrydisproportionatelycostly risks should be approachedcautiously, whether they be financial decisions or partieal life choices.This is, of course, a very simplifiedscenario,butthe point is thatknowledge is relational and the understanding of wisdom recognizes that rather than treating it simply as an isolated information point.Instead of the lesson being that cheating is bad, youcombine the essence of the knowledge learned from that experience with yourexistinglatticeworkof previous knowledgeto reallyhammerhome the underlying principle.This way, you understand how taking shortcuts may harm your personal relationships, how your new understanding of risk may inform your business practices, andhowwhat you say matters beyond why you say it.Knowledge is always bestleveragedwhen its connected to other knowledge.Creating an information networkInnetwork science, there is a now-famous effect calledMetcalfeslaw.It was first used to describe the growth of telec ommunication networks, but over time, the application has been extended beyond that.It essentially states thatthe value of a network rises with the number of connected users.In any network, each thing of interest is a node and the connection between such things is a link.The number ofnodesthemselves doesnt necessarily reflect the value of a network, but the number of links between those nodes does.For example, ten independent phones by themselves arent really all that useful. What makes them useful is the connection that they have to other phones.And the more they are connected to other phones, the more useful they are because the more access they have to each other.Well,the relationship between different kinds of knowledge in our mind works the same way.The moreconnectedthey are to each other, the more valuable the information network that we have in our brain is.Every time you gain knowledge, you are either isolating it within a narrow contextwhere its addressing a particular prob lem,or you are breaking it down a little further so that you can connect that knowledge to the already existing information youveaccumulatedso far.In this scenario,intelligence is found within a pocket of information by itself.Wisdom, however, is accumulated in the process of creating new links.Each node of knowledge in your mind is a mental model of some aspect of reality, butthatmental model isnt fully complete untilits been stripped down andre-contextualizedin light of the information contained in the other mental models of knowledge around it.The only way to acquire wisdom is to thinkin terms of the whole information network rather than theindividualnodes that it contains.Thats wherenuanceis considered, thats where the respect for complexity comes in, andthats how specialized information finds its flexibility.Thestrength of your mind depends on the value of your information network.The takeawayThequestfor wisdom is an age-old effort. Its one many have recommended.Its been said t o be as useful for finding innercontentmentas it is for fueling external successes.Its a moreprudentway of interacting with reality.While not everyones definition of wisdom is the same, it doesnt seem toofar-fetchedto distinguish it by a mode of deeper understanding.One that goes beyond just the knowing we commonly associate with intelligence.When we think of theacquisitionofintelligence, we think of new information inspired bya perspective-shift that tells us a truth about one aspect of reality.Wisdom goes furtherthanthat.Itstripsthat same informationdown to its essence so that it can relate the underlying principle of that knowledge to the existing information networkthat exists in the mind.Its theconnectednessof this network that separates it from mere intelligence.The more links between each pocket of information, the more valuable the whole network will be whentacklingany other problem.It adds an extra dimension to each mental model contained in the mind.Simply knowing this doe snt make a person more equipped tosoakin wisdom, but withawareness and practice, new thinking patterns can be created.The way you do this shapes everything else. Lies Job Searchers Believe About an Online Presence -The MuseLies Job Searchers Believe About an Online Presence When youre job searching, you no doubt have so many things on your to-do list (update your resume, tailor your cover letters, make sure you have the right interview outfit), that you may be tempted to skim over an important factor your online presence.Maybe you think that youre all set- your old college photos have been deleted from Facebook and your LinkedIn profile is current. Or, perhaps you havent bothered to develop much of an online persona at all, so you think youve got nothing to worry about. Regardless of how your digital self can be characterized, you cant underestimate the importance of it. The nature of todays job search and recruiters tendency to take a deep look at a candidates online presence means that you have to be extra careful about whats out there- and whats not. The lies youre telling yourself can actually mean the difference between a job offer and a rejection letter (and nobody wants that).1. I Wont Be Judged By What I Have (or Dont Have) OnlineWeve all been told over and over to be mindful of what we put on Facebook. But, if you take that advice at face value, youre missing out on huge portion of your online presence. When you Google yourself (most hiring managers will do just this), make note of which other sites link to your name. Maybe youve got an outdated (possibly embarrassing) Reddit profile or Pinterest page thats you rather not have a future employer see. Nows the time to do a thorough review of everything out there tied to your name. While you cant delete everything from Google search like an online newspaper story that mentions your name, or a profile on an old site that wont let you delete your account, you can at least be aware of anything you may need to acknowledge or explain to your interviewer like that controversial article youre quoted in, or the traffic misdemeanor from nine years ago that still shows up.R ead More Hiring Managers Will Google You- Heres What You Can Do Now if the Results Arent Good2. I Only Need a Portfolio or Personal Website for a Creative CareerIts true that almost every creative position (like designer, developer, creative director, writer) requires a portfolio of sorts, but, you shouldnt rule out the usefulness of having your own personal website even if youre not looking for a creative job. It comes in handy when applying to almost any position Youll look tech-savvy, professional, and it may even help bump your resume to the top of the pile. Its Too Late to StartMaybe your prior profession didnt require (or even encourage) social media pa rticipation. And now youre looking to transition to a job in a different field. Lets say the rules for this career path are completely different from your last, and an online presence is highly encouraged, and pretty much expected, of all applicants- and you dont have one Dont let your lack of a Twitter following, or even the absence of a LinkedIn profile discourage you from getting on board at last. Its really never too late to build a personal brand and showcase yourself and your accomplishments online. Youll have to clear some space on your schedule to dive in, but after a few hours of completing the anfangsbuchstabe setup and learning your way around the different platforms, 15 minutes a day or so is plenty to keep you current. Although you may not have the same knowledge as some of your competition who have been using these tools for years, at least youll show that youre aware of whats a normal web presence for the career youre transitioning to, and youre making progress to get there.
